Driver / Messenger

Main purpose of job:

To provide reliable and courteous transportation service to customers with safety as top priority; to provide a communication link between customers and staff; to operate and maintain assigned vehicle(s); and to maintain vehicle and customer records.

Roles and responsibilities:

  • Operate assigned vehicle in a safe and courteous manner
  • Maintain defensive driving
  • Provide a communication link between customers and staff,
  • Assist all passengers in and out of the vehicle; operate ramps, lifts and secure devices as needed
  • Read and interpret maps and driving directions to plan the most efficient route service for customers, and read and interpret road signs in English;
  • Present safety briefing to passengers prior to each trip departure;
  • Keep the assigned vehicle(s) clean inside and outside;
  • Check water, gas, oil and mechanical condition before leaving on run.
  • Report delays and accidents.
  • Maintain accurate, up-to-date records on trip sheets, customer transportation forms, vehicle maintenance, fuel purchases, incident reports, accident reports, vehicle condition reports and other records that are requested from management;
  • Report defects or problems with vehicle to supervisor.
  • Perform minor vehicle repairs;
  • Interpret policies and procedures, maps, and route directions; and ability to administer First Aid,
  • Perform minor maintenance tasks on assigned vehicle(s) as required;
  • Fuel the assigned vehicle(s);
  • Coordinate the schedule for major or periodic vehicle maintenance with management and staff to minimize service interruptions;
  • Respond immediately to accident or medical emergencies by notifying emergency response providers, and rendering First Aid until emergency personnel arrive
  • Register vehicles at the DVLA for both official and private UK Based Staff.
  • Perform minor protocol duties at the Airport.
